Abstract

An automated Breast Milk Pumping Machine system milking machine system was created for mothers with babies. A covering will be placed on the breast when using this milk pumping system. The relevant bottle will be attached to the cover. When the motor pump is turned on, the vacuum created by the motor pump permits the milk to flow out from breast through into bottle. One of the helping tool items that mothers bring with them when pumping breastmilk is a pumping breastmilk machine. Mothers who are passengers or drivers will utilize this pumping breastmilk machine in the vehicle if necessary. To monitoring the breastmilk pumping is important to prevent wasting the milk when the bottle is full. However, the mothers are facing difficulties when they need to constantly monitoring the amount of milk in the bottle especially during driving. Therefore, the idea of this project is to help promote motherhood by developing an automated breast milk pumping system. The non-contact liquid sensor is attached to the NodeMCU as a smart tool for monitoring the milk level and is added to the current pump system. When the bottle has reached the predetermined level, when a sensor non-contact liquid detects and sends a signal, the pump will immediately shut down. Then, NodeMCU will send the notification thru Blynk to alert the mother of the current condition of the pumping breastmilk machine, as well as an alarm to alert the mother. It will also give the record on duration time taken to fill up a bottle for mother's references.
